Calvert Hospice Announces Educational Seminar at Calvert Memorial Hospital

Calvert Hospice Announces Educational Seminar at Calvert Memorial Hospital

Calvert Hospice is partnering with Calvert Memorial Hospital to provide educational seminars to our community. Attendees will learn about topics that impact end-of-life care for patients and their families. Sessions are designed to encourage group discussion.
